Dejero Transforms KNSD-TV和KUAN-LD’s Mobile Broadcast Truck into Mobile TV Station

Dejero网关, 通路, WayPoint and CellSat combine to deliver unparalleled one-stop shop connectivity for new KNSD-TV和KUAN-LD mobile broadcast truck

Dejero使NBC圣地亚哥广播公司成为可能, KNSD-TV和KUAN-LD, 把它的新移动广播车变成一个独立的, 端到端移动电视演播室. The Dejero equipment on board the truck — including the Dejero网关 M6E6 网work aggregation device, 路径E编码器, and a WayPoint 104 receiver — gives KNSD-TV和KUAN-LD the bandwidth to work fully independently in the field, 处理, editing and distributing live raw video without reliance on teams and equipment located back at the broadcast facility. 卡车, 它是由艾美奖获奖卡车制造商和移动集成商建造的, 加速媒体技术, (AMT), is able to act as a backup station in case the main broadcast facility needs to be evacuated, 这种情况可能在最近的COVID-19大流行期间发生.

“We are thrilled with our new truck and are particularly impressed with the power and flexibility of the Dejero equipment, 特别是GateWay网络聚合设备,迈克·福奇说, nbc环球传媒的技术经理, KNSD-TV. “In the past we would have used an encoder/transmitter to access cellular 网works or traditional microwave/satellite to get a signal in, but with the Dejero网关 we can transport video as well as have general-purpose connectivity so we can access all of our in-house systems remotely through private 网works, 公共互联网和云. 所以现在, the field team can be autonomous and rely less on those back at the station to manage content.”

KNSD-TV approached the team at AMT for the provision of what they termed a ‘Swiss Army Knife Truck’ — in essence, a vehicle that was able to both switch a newscast out of the truck in the event the studio facility was inaccessible, 并接收多个通道的手机视频数据直接发送到卡车上. The big challenge lay in getting significant return bandwidth to the truck by allowing the team to receive field assets and to relay them via cellular or satellite 网works without having to have another high bandwidth service plan.

The backbone to Dejero’s solutions is its patented Smart Blending Technology which simultaneously aggregates diverse wired and wireless IP connections from multiple sources to form a virtual ‘网work of 网works’, 提高连接路径的可靠性, 扩大覆盖范围,提供更大带宽.

“Dejero is in a league of its own when it comes to critical connectivity in mobile and nomadic scenarios,汤姆·詹宁斯说, AMT总裁. “我亲自测试了这个系统, in the rural hills of Montana where cell frequencies can barely be counted on to make a normal phone call, I experienced data rates upwards of 30 Mbps constantly and without linking to a satellite.詹宁斯补充道, “总的来说, Smart Blending Technology has helped transform the once behemoth DSNG truck into a highly maneuverable, 成本有效的平台,需要较少的正式培训来操作. 它扩大了新闻卡车在路上的覆盖范围和质量.”

通过持续实时测量每个连接, GateWay dynamically distributes packets across the available multiple connections, 充分利用它们的综合带宽潜力, 实现高达100mbps的上传速度和250mbps的下载速度.

The availability of Smart Blending Technology has created an unprecedented high capacity, 卡车内部的双向数据管道, 为任何类型的IP数据提供惊人的吞吐量. The Dejero网关 delivers critical connectivity to the truck and provides KNSD-TV和KUAN-LD with reliable access to the Inter网, cloud applications such as Latakoo for ENG video and AWS WorkSpaces for accessing content at the station, as well as private 网works from the mobile field locations of KNSD-TV和KUAN-LD’s remote workforce.

卡车使用Dejero CellSat连接服务, intelligently blending cellular connectivity from multiple mobile 网work providers with Ku-band IP satellite connectivity from Intelsat when needed — reliably delivering the bandwidth to transmit broadcast-quality video in real time in all scenarios. The Dejero 通路 E is an adaptive bitrate encoder in a 1U short-depth rack-mount form-factor, 非常适合安装在空间有限的车辆上. 最后, the Dejero WayPoint 104 receiver reconstructs video transported over multiple IP connections from Dejero transmitters, 解码HEVC或AVC, 并将其输出到KNSD-TV或KUAN-LD所需的工作流程- SDI或MPEG-TS.
